Sub-literate subordinates! All are present in these rip-roaring, wild, galaxy-hopping adventures of the crew of A Terran Starship. A Terran Starship attempts to bring good old-fashioned FREEDOM to Uranus and fails! Instead, hard pounding action slams them into the darkest depths of Uranus as a power struggle unfolds with awkwardly hilarious results, entangling them in a vast, intergalactic struggle for dominance.
